Job description

We are looking for a skilled and compliance-driven Azure Cloud Edge Test Engineer to join our medical device engineering team connecting our devices to our Azure cloud services. In this role, you will be responsible for designing, developing, and executing test strategies for cloud-edge solutions built on Microsoft Azure that power connected medical devices and clinical systems. You will work closely with software engineers, regulatory affairs specialists, DevOps teams, and product managers to ensure the reliability, performance, safety, and security of edge-computing workloads within a highly regulated healthcare environment., * Design and implement comprehensive test plans, test cases, and test automation frameworks for Azure edge computing solutions supporting connected medical devices, including Azure IoT Edge and Azure Arc.

  • Develop and maintain automated test suites for edge device deployments, containerized workloads, and cloud-to-device communication pipelines in compliance with applicable regulatory standards.
  • Conduct functional, regression, integration, performance, and security testing across cloud-edge environments, adhering to IEC 62304 (software lifecycle), ISO 14971 (risk management), and IEC 62443 (cybersecurity) frameworks.
  • Support the creation and maintenance of Design History Files (DHF), Software Development Files (SDF), and other quality system documentation required for FDA and CE submissions.
  • Validate edge device provisioning, configuration management, and OTA (over-the-air) update mechanisms with full traceability to system requirements.
  • Test network reliability and data integrity under adverse edge conditions, including low-bandwidth, intermittent-connectivity, and offline scenarios - with particular attention to patient safety implications.
  • Design and execute test strategies for clinical web applications, including functional, cross-browser, accessibility (WCAG 2.1), and end-to-end UI testing using tools such as Ranorex, Playwright, Selenium, or Cypress.
  • Validate custom Azure cloud services (REST/GraphQL APIs, microservices, serverless functions, and data pipelines) through contract testing, load testing, and fault injection to ensure correctness, resilience, and regulatory traceability.
  • Test data flows end-to-end across the full stack - from edge device telemetry through cloud processing services to web application presentation layers - verifying data integrity, latency SLAs, and audit logging at each tier.
  • Collaborate with Regulatory Affairs and Quality Assurance teams to ensure test activities satisfy 21 CFR Part 11, 21 CFR Part 820, and EU MDR 2017/745 requirements.
  • Integrate testing into CI/CD pipelines using Azure DevOps, maintaining validated state throughout the pipeline.
  • Identify, document, and track defects through to resolution, ensuring proper risk classification and impact assessment per ISO 14971.
  • Perform root cause analysis on test failures and support CAPA (Corrective and Preventive Action) processes as required.
  • Participate in design reviews, hazard analyses (FMEA/FMECA), and usability engineering activities related to software and edge systems.
  • Stay current with FDA guidance on software as a medical device (SaMD), Azure platform updates, and evolving edge computing and cybersecurity standards.

Requirements

  • Bachelor’s degree in Computer Science, Software Engineering, Biomedical Engineering, Electrical Engineering, or a related field (or equivalent practical experience).
  • 3+ years of experience in the medical device industry and software quality assurance or test engineering, with at least 2 years focused on cloud or edge computing environments.
  • Demonstrated experience working in an FDA-regulated or ISO 13485-certified medical device environment.
  • Hands-on experience with Microsoft Azure services, particularly Azure IoT Hub and Azure IoT Edge.
  • Familiarity with medical device software standards including IEC 62304, ISO 14971, and 21 CFR Part 820.
  • Proficiency in test automation using languages/frameworks such as Python, PowerShell or Bash.
  • Solid understanding of containerization technologies (Docker, Kubernetes), message bus (Service Bus) and microservices architectures.
  • Experience integrating automated tests into CI/CD pipelines while maintaining a validated, audit-ready state.
  • Experience testing web applications using modern frameworks (Ranorex, Playwright, Selenium, Cypress, or equivalent), including API testing with tools such as Postman or REST Assured.
  • Hands-on experience testing custom cloud services including REST/GraphQL APIs, Azure Functions, Logic Apps, and event-driven architectures (Azure Service Bus, Event Hub).
  • Familiarity with performance and load testing tools such as Azure Load Testing for cloud services and web applications.
  • Familiarity with networking and security concepts relevant to edge computing (TCP/IP, MQTT, TLS/SSL, VPN).
  • Strong analytical and problem-solving skills with a systematic approach to debugging, defect isolation, and risk-based testing.

About the company

HistoSonics is a commercial-stage medtech company advancing the Edison® System, a novel non-invasive sonic beam therapy based on histotripsy. Since receiving FDA De Novo grant for the non-invasive destruction of liver tumors in 2023, the company has progressed beyond initial market entry into commercial expansion, reimbursement momentum, and ongoing clinical and pipeline development. In addition to its current liver tumor indication, HistoSonics is pursuing future indications across multiple applications including kidney, pancreas, prostate, neuro, women’s health, and other significant underserved human health areas, to realize the broader potential histotripsy across multiple disease states and medical specialties.
